The integrated circuit devices have an integrated circuit chip mounted on a ceramic card and electrically connected to printed circuit paths on the card, the circuit paths terminating with small center-to-center spacings between the paths along an edge of the card. The connectors receive edges of the cards and have contacts on small center-to-center spacings detachably engaging respective circuit path terminations along the card edges. 1. A panel board system comprising: a plurality of integrated circuit devices each embodying dielectric means, an integrated circuit chip having a plurality of chip terminals mounted on said dielectric means, and a plurality of electrically conductive paths disposed in electrically insulated relation to each other on said dielectric means, said conductive paths being electrically connected to respective chip terminals and terminating with first, selected, center-to-center spacings between said paths at one edge of said dielectric means; a plurality of connectors each embodying dielectric body means and a plurality of electrical contact means disposed in electrically insulated relation to each other on said dielectric body means, each of said connectors having a recess receiving said one edge of one of said integrated circuit devices therein for mounting said integrated circuit device on said connector; said contact means in each of said connectors having first contact portions with said first center-to-center spacings therebetween detachably engaging respective terminations of said conductive paths on the integrated circuit device which is mounted on said connector, said contact means in each connector having respective terminal post portions extending from said connector in staggered parallel relation to each other with second, relatively larger center-to-center spacings between said terminal post portions of said contact means; a dielectric panel board having apertures receiving said terminal post portions of said connector contact means therein for mounting said connectors on said panel board; and means electrically interconnecting selected terminal post portions of said connector contact means.
2. A panel board system as set forth in claim 1 wherein said first center-to-center spacings are less than 0.100 inches and said second center-to-center spacings are at least 0.100 inches, and wherein said selected terminal post portions of said connector contact means are electrically interconnected by wire wrap means.
3. A panel board system as set forth in claim 1 wherein said dielectric body means of each of said connectors has a recess therein receiving said one edge of one of said integrated circuit devices for mounting said integrated circuit device on said connector, and wherein said contact means in each of said connectors each embodies a resilient leaf portion and a terminal post portion, said contact meAns in each connector having said contact leaf portions disposed in a row within said body recess of said connector with said first center-to-center spacings between said leaf portions, said leaf portions detachably engaging respective terminations of said conductive paths on the integrated circuit device received within said recess.
4. A panel board system comprising: a plurality of integrated circuit devices each embodying a rigid, dielectric card, an integrated circuit chip having a plurality of chip terminals mounted on one side surface of said card, and about 40 electrically conductive paths disposed in electrically insulated relation to each other on said one card surface, said conductive paths being electrically connected to respective chip terminals and terminating with about 0.050 inch center-to-center spacings between said paths at one edge of said one card surface; a plurality of connectors mounting respective integrated circuit devices thereon, each of said connectors embodying dielectric body means having a recess receiving said one edge of one of said integrated circuit device cards therein for mounting said integrated circuit device on said connector, each of said connectors having a plurality of electrical contact members of two different configurations which each have a resilient leaf portion and a terminal post portion, each of said connectors having said contact members of said different configurations disposed in alternate, electrically insulated relation to each other on said dielectric body means of said connector and having said leaf portions of said contact members disposed in a row within said recess in said dielectric connector body means with said 0.050 inch center-to-center spacings between said contact leaf portions for detachably engaging respective terminations of said conductive paths on the integrated circuit device received within said recess; said contact members in each connector having said terminal post portions thereof extending from said connector is staggered parallel relation to each other with at least 0.100 inch center-to-center spacings between said terminal post portions; a dielectric panel board having apertures receiving said terminal post portions of said connector contact members therein for mounting said connectors on said panel board; and wire wrap means electrically interconnecting selected terminal post portions of said connector contact members.
5. A connector for mounting an integrated circuit device on a panel board, said connector comprising a dielectric body means having a recess for receiving one edge of an integrated circuit device therein, and a plurality of electrical contact means mounted in electrically insulated relation to each other on said dielectric body means, said contact means each embodying a resilient leaf portion and a terminal post portion, said contact means having said leaf portions thereof disposed in a row within said recess with first center-to-center spacing therebetween for detachably engaging terminations of conductive paths on the integrated circuit device received within said recess, said terminal post portions of said contact means extending from said conductor in staggered parallel relation to each other with second, relatively larger center-to-center spacings therebetween.
6. A connector as set forth in claim 5 wherein said first center-to-center spacings of said contact leaf portions are less than 0.100 inches and wherein said second center-to-center spacings of said terminal post portions of said contact means are at least 0.100 inches.
